Video Player is loading.

Up next


Solid Proofs that Turkey's President Firavun Pharaoh Recep Tayyip Erdogan is a Freemason in Istanbul Templar Palace

JamesRoss
JamesRoss - 532 Views
442
532 Views
Published on 19 Sep 2021 / In People and Blogs

By Sean Hross the Homeless Traveling Historian
Source: https://live.ahava528.com/v/8082?channelName=GIUREH

Show more
0 Comments sort Sort by

Up next